Which of these molecules are polar? check all that apply. co2 so2 ch2cl2 pcl3?

Polar molecules are molecules with net dipole due to the presence of partial positive and partial negative charge. For example, water is a polar molecule that has partial positive and partial negative charge on it. CO2 is a non polar compound.

Answer: The following molecules are polar:
SO2- It is polar because it has dipole moment.
CH2Cl2
PCl3

Explain The element lithium has two common isotopes: Li–6 and Li–7 If the average atomic mass of lithium is 6.94004 u, determine
rosijanka [135]

Answer:

%Li-6 = 5.996% & %Li-7 = 94.004%

Explanation:

let X₁ = Li-6 & X₂ = Li-7 where Xₙ = mole fraction

X₁ + X₂ = 1 => X₁ = 1 - X₂

6·X₁ + 7·X₂ = 6.94004

=> 6(1 - X₂) + 7·X₂ = 6.94004

=> 6 - 6·X₂ + 7·X₂ = 6.94004

=> 6 + X₂ = 6.94004

X₂ = 6.94004 - 6 = 0.94004 => %X₂ = %Li-7 = 94.004%

X₁ = 1.00000 - 0.94004 = 0.05996 => %X₁ = %Li-6 = 5.996%
